Positions in this function are responsible for mentoring/training within a function such as claim, customer service, or enrollment. Does not train outside of specialty. This position is instrumental in COBRA Administration training of team member’s state-side and global in current system as well as Web-COBRA. This can include training on CPS Enrollment, TravisCobra software, Microsoft Access databases, customer service classes, Outlook, new employee orientations, etc.
